The Hidden Wonders of Biomimicry: Nature's Blueprint for Innovation

Biomimicry, the practice of emulating nature's designs and processes to solve human problems, is a rapidly growing field that holds immense potential for advancements in various industries and disciplines. By harnessing the wisdom of millions of years of evolution, biomimics aim to create sustainable and efficient solutions inspired by the intricate mechanisms found in the natural world.

Unveiling Nature's Ingenuity

Nature has evolved a vast array of adaptations that provide unique and effective ways to address challenges in areas such as flight, adhesion, camouflage, and energy efficiency. For instance, the wing structure of owls enables silent flight, inspiring the design of quieter aircraft wings. Geckos' adhesive feet have paved the way for the development of strong and reusable adhesives. The Namib Desert beetle's ability to collect water from fog has led to the creation of water-harvesting devices.

Bridging Innovation across Industries

Biomimicry finds applications in various fields, including:

  • Architecture: Creating energy-efficient buildings inspired by termite mounds and honeycombs.
  • Medicine: Developing drug delivery systems based on the bombardier beetle's defensive mechanism.
  • Energy: Harnessing bioluminescent bacteria for sustainable light sources.
  • Materials Science: Fabricating lightweight and durable materials inspired by spider silk and seashells.
  • Transportation: Designing high-speed trains modeled after the streamlined shape of kingfishers.
  • Driving Sustainable Solutions

    Biomimicry promotes sustainability by focusing on mimicking nature's efficient use of resources. By learning from nature's closed-loop systems, biomimics aim to minimize waste and optimize energy consumption. For example, biomimetic wind turbine blades inspired by humpback whale fins reduce noise and increase efficiency.

    Challenges and Opportunities

    While biomimicry offers tremendous possibilities, challenges remain in implementing its principles. Understanding complex biological systems and translating them into practical applications requires a multidisciplinary approach. Additionally, there is a need for greater awareness and adoption of biomimicry in industry and research.

    Despite these challenges, biomimicry presents an exciting frontier for innovation and sustainability. By embracing nature's designs, we can create technologies and products that are more efficient, environmentally friendly, and ultimately in harmony with the natural world.
